What Is Covered Under Indoor Farming Market?

Indoor farming refers to the practice of growing crops or plants entirely inside buildings or enclosed structures without relying on natural outdoor conditions. This method of agriculture allows for year-round cultivation, regardless of external weather conditions, by managing factors such as temperature, light, humidity, and water. Indoor farming can occur in various settings, including greenhouses, vertical farms, or specially designed indoor facilities. The main types of indoor farming are hardware, software, and services. Hardware refers to the physical components and machinery used in various technologies and systems, such as computers, electronics, and agricultural equipment. These tools help create optimal growing conditions for plants in a controlled environment. The various crop categories include fruits, vegetables and herbs, flowers and ornamentals, and others and several growing systems utilized are aeroponics, hydroponics, aquaponics, soil-based, and hybrid systems. The multiple facility types include glass or poly greenhouses, indoor vertical farms, container farms, indoor deep water culture systems, and others.

What Is The Indoor Farming Market Size and Share 2026?

The indoor farming market size has grown rapidly in recent years. It will grow from $33.15 billion in 2025 to $36.94 billion in 2026 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.4%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to limited agricultural land availability, early adoption of greenhouse farming, rising demand for fresh produce, initial technological advancements in indoor systems, increasing urban population density.

What Is The Indoor Farming Market Growth Forecast?

The indoor farming market size is expected to see rapid growth in the next few years. It will grow to $56.27 billion in 2030 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.1%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to growing shift toward sustainable food systems, rising investment in vertical farms, increasing energy-efficient indoor farming innovations, expansion of commercial indoor farm operators, growing preference for locally grown produce. Major trends in the forecast period include rising adoption of vertical farming structures, increasing focus on year-round controlled cultivation, higher demand for pesticide-free indoor-grown produce, expansion of urban food production facilities, growing popularity of specialty crop cultivation indoors.

What Is Driver Of The Indoor Farming Market?

The increasing demand for organic food is expected to propel the growth of the indoor farming market going forward. Organic food refers to products grown and processed without synthetic chemicals, pesticides, fertilizers, genetically modified organisms (GMOs), or artificial additives. The demand for organic foods is due to growing consumer awareness of health benefits, environmental sustainability, and the desire for natural, chemical-free products. Indoor farming is used for organic food production by providing a controlled environment where crops can be grown without synthetic pesticides, fertilizers, or GMOs, ensuring adherence to organic standards while optimizing plant health and productivity conditions. For instance, in May 2024, according to the Organic Trade Association, a US-based organic industry, in 2023, the U.S. organic market maintained its upward trend, with organic food sales reaching $63.8 billion and organic non-food product sales totaling $5.9 billion. Altogether, certified organic product sales in the United States climbed to a record high of $69.7 billion, representing a 3.4% increase compared to the previous year. Therefore, increasing demand for organic food is driving the growth of indoor farming.

What Are Latest Mergers And Acquisitions In The Indoor Farming Market? Denso Corporation Acquires Certhon Build B.V. To Expand into Indoor Farming Sector

In August 2023, Denso Corporation, a Japan-based automotive component manufacturer, acquired Certhon Build B.V. for an undisclosed amount. With this acquisition, Denso aims to enhance its capabilities in the indoor farming sector by integrating Certhon Build B.V.'s expertise in advanced greenhouse and vertical farming systems, expanding its technology solutions, and strengthening its market presence in agricultural technology. Certhon Build B.V. is a Netherlands-based company that designs and constructs advanced indoor farming systems.
